Frequently Asked Questions

What are the key features of the Emissary Development Handbrake?

The Emissary Development Handbrake features a forward-swept angle for enhanced ergonomics, an optimized size with tapered walls for comfort, proprietary texture for grip, an anti-slip bottom ledge, and built-in front/rear barricade stops. It's also ultra-lightweight and made in the USA.

How does the Emissary Handbrake compare in weight to other popular foregrips?

The Emissary Development Handbrake weighs just 26 grams. This is lighter than the Magpul Angled Foregrip, which weighs 34 grams, and significantly lighter than the BCM Gunfighter Vertical Grip, weighing 54 grams.

What is the installation process for the Emissary Handbrake?

Installation is straightforward. You select your desired M-LOK slot placement on the rifle's handguard, align the handbrake's hardware, and secure it using the provided screws and a T25 Torx bit. Ensure the firearm is unloaded before starting.
